From multi-chain and public chains to EVM, Layer 2, gas and confirmations, understand the network before moving assets.
A multi-chain experience does not merge networks; it keeps each network’s assets, fees and transaction state clearly separated in one interface.
After broadcast, a transaction must enter blocks and receive confirmations according to that network’s rules. Block explorers help verify public state.
EVM networks share account and contract concepts, but network IDs, gas assets, deployments and token addresses still need independent checks.
Cross-layer transfers may involve bridges, waiting periods and different confirmation logic. Do not infer the network from how an address looks.
Gas reflects the network cost of execution, while confirmation count reflects how far a transaction has progressed after inclusion in a block. Both may change with congestion.

Connecting a wallet does not mean every signature request should be accepted. Verify the domain before visiting a DApp, then review account requests, signature details and approval scope.
Security
Seed phrases and private keys remain under the user’s control; official staff will not ask for them. Before transferring, signing or approving, verify the network, address, amount, target and permission scope. Public devices, public Wi‑Fi, remote-control tools, clipboard substitution and lookalike domains can increase risk. Because on-chain transactions generally cannot be reversed by a wallet alone, checking first is the more reliable habit.

Start with addresses, seed phrases, private keys, networks, gas, transaction hashes, DApps and approvals before moving real assets. Addresses identify accounts, seed phrases and private keys establish control, the network determines where a transaction executes, and gas plus transaction hashes help explain cost and status. DApps and approvals add a separate permission layer that must be reviewed on its own.
